Make sure you have that lower control arm as far down as it will go. You may need to rent a coil spring spacer. I dident need one when doing my 2 inch spacer but your spring and setup is prolly different. What i did was get the top of the spring in first then use my foot to press down the lower control arm as far as it will go and put in the spring.
